What does floating quota mean?
In order to avoid the embarrassment that customers can't pay when using credit cards because they forget to apply for an increase in the temporary limit, some banks will control the maximum credit card consumption at 1 10% of the original limit according to relevant regulations, and the excess is called floating limit. In other words, if the cardholder's credit limit is 20,000 yuan, then the cardholder's credit card can directly spend up to 22,000 yuan. If it exceeds 2000 yuan, the bank can charge a certain percentage of the overrun fee.

General credit card, you apply for a basic limit. The bank will adjust the quota according to your consumption record and repayment speed, and basically there will be a floating quota.

credit card

Credit card, also called debit card, is a credit certificate issued by a commercial bank or credit card company to eligible consumers. It is a card with name, expiration date, number and cardholder's name printed on the front, and a magnetic stripe and signature strip on the back. Consumers with credit cards can go to specialized commercial service departments for shopping or spending, and then the bank will settle accounts with merchants and cardholders, and cardholders can overdraw within the prescribed limits.
